Malaysian tourist influx remains steady despite uncertainty in Thailand’s south

Malaysians are visiting Thailand, undeterred by problems in the deep south. (via Malaysian Reserve)

Malaysians are still streaming into Songkhla, despitesafety concerns and uncertainties following the recent fireworks warehouse explosion and car bombing in Narathiwat. The blasts brought ensuing speculation over safety concerns across Thailand’s southernmost provinces. But an average of 10,000 Malaysian tourists each day are visiting Southern Thailand anyway.

Songchai Mungprasithichai, spearheading the Songkhla Tourism Promotion Association, expressed that the steady surge of Malaysian influx has largely remained unnerved and unaffected by the hasty disruptions in the Deep South provinces. These travellers, hailing from the neighbouring country, have over time grown accustomed to unpredictable incidents in Thailand’s volatile southernmost provinces.
